This E-book presents the Brahmavarga of the Amarakosha, which is a comprehensive collection of words related to the intellectual and spiritual aspects of human society. It includes terms associated with scholars, teachers, students, ascetics, philosophical traditions, Vedic learning, yajna-s, rituals, and other sacred practices. This varga also presents vocabulary connected with education, religious duties, and the traditional way of life described in Sanskrit literature.
This E-book is designed to be both engaging and educational. It presents the mula in Devanagari and IAST, along with line-by-line meanings in Sanskrit and English, supported by padaccheda, anvaya, and padaparichaya. Reading variants are also included to aid accurate study and recitation. All synonyms are presented in prathama vibhakti to support easy recognition and memorisation. Regular study of Amarakosha helps improve memory, focus, concentration, and Sanskrit vocabulary.
